Ordering.

All orders start with an email or phone call. If you're in the area we can arrange to meet at the shop, discuss your ideas for a build, do a fitting, and hopefully have a coffee or a beer. If a local fitting isn't possible we can arrange one to be done in your area, or take measurements off an an existing bicycle and fine tune the geometry to best suit your needs. My current wait as of winter 2015/spring 2016 is about four months. I ask for a $500 deposit to get a place on the build list.

Componentry is essential to have on hand to provide proper fit and clearances. As a life long mechanic I enjoy helping you select the parts that will integrate best with your bike. At the beginning of the build I will invoice you for the parts balance, or ask that you mail your parts to my workshop. Vintage parts may be available, but can take time to source. Please inquire early in the process if you are interested.

Once I begin the build I will keep you regularly updated through my Flickr page. This is a good time to talk about finish options. After the frameset is complete and sent to the painters I ask that the remainder of the balance is paid. You can pick up your assembled bicycle at my shop, or help me arrange to have it shipped to you.
